Introduction
TheBiggieG has been on a weight loss journey for the past 2.5 years, with the goal of feeling confident and healthy in his own skin. He has had his ups and downs, but he's come a long way and now wants to share his experience on Reddit. Over the years, his weight has fluctuated between 240lbs, down to 180lbs, and back up to 200lbs. Nevertheless, he's achieved an impressive 40-pound weight loss.
The Journey
TheBiggieG began his weight loss journey with a simple realization: he was sick and tired of feeling uncomfortable and unattractive. His first step was recognizing that change was necessary and taking it one day at a time. He cut back on calorie intake and incorporated exercise into his daily routine, starting with just a few push-ups a day and gradually increasing the difficulty and duration of his workouts. It was not an easy journey, but consistency and discipline were key.
The Challenges
TheBiggieG faced numerous challenges on his weight loss journey, from the temptation of eating junk food to struggling with his body image. However, he found ways to overcome these challenges by setting realistic goals, finding healthy food alternatives, and surrounding himself with a supportive community. He also learned to focus on non-scale victories, such as fitting into clothing better and being able to run farther or lift heavier weights.
